PlayStation's answer to Halo, Killzone 2 offers unmatched graphics as you are Sergeant Shevchenko, whose only one grunt among many in the retaliatory invasion of Helgan by the ISA forces.


Snake is back, aged, but still as effective as ever. MGS4 answers many of the outstanding questions of the MGS universe and a fitting finale for the soldier who bested Big Boss.


ZEUS! Kratos is back in the jaw-dropping finale to the God of War trilogy. Watch as Kratos takes on both the Titans in the battle for Olympus.


Despite it being a launch title, Resistance still holds up as an amazing game, 3 years after its release. Set in an alternative 50s, where an alien race the Chimera have invaded Europe, you play Sgt. Hale tasked with defending the realm.
